Prithvi Theatre Festival 2017

The Prithvi Theatre Festival 2017, one of the most celebrated theatre festivals in the city, is around the corner. It runs from the 3rd to 13th of November 2017.

The highlights at the main theatre:

6 Premiere Productions
Sufi Performance by NOORAN SISTERS
1 Indian Classical Music Concert Performance - pure natural acoustics
1 Western Classical Music Concert by Symphony Orchestra of India -
pure natural acoustics
1 Fusion Dance performance - Where Indian and Western styles merge
1 Ramleela in Urdu
1 Carnival
8 Platform Performances


The highlights at Prithvi House:
5 Fringe Theatre productions
4 StageTalk@Prithvi - discussions with eminent Theatre practitioners about the working journey through Theatre
PEN@Prithvi - Literary Encounter
Chai&Why? - Explore the wonders of Science with TIFR in a theatrical manner

Some of the groups participating in the Festival are Motley, Ansh, Rage, D for Drama, Aasakta Kalamanch, The Hoshruba Repertory, Rahen, Sri Shraddha Ramlila Committee and others.
